Engin Yağız Hatay gave a presentation on graphics and animation capabilities in web browsers. He discussed several technologies including CSS3, Canvas, SVG, and WebGL, and when each is best suited. He provided details on HTML5 Canvas capabilities and limitations. Hatay also covered browser support for these technologies and recommended several JavaScript libraries that can be used to create graphics and animations, including PaperJS, ProcessingJS, and ThreeJS. He concluded with a discussion of tools and frameworks for mobile graphics development.

6. HTML5 - Canvas
• 2D Drawing platform
• All you need is plain JavaScript
• Created by Apple (Used for dashboard
widgets)
• Now it’s an HTML5 Standard
• «Resolution dependent bitmap»
Which means every visual is represented by
pixels (non-vectoral)
7. HTML5-Canvas (cont.)
• You can save the resulting image as a .png or
.jpg.
• There are no DOM nodes for anything you
draw. It is all pixels.
• Not suited for Web site or application user
interfaces.
• Requires you to manually redraw each
element in the interface

9. SVG
• Resolution independent
• Allows scaling for any screen resolution.
• Very good support for animations. Elements can be
animated using a declarative syntax, or via JavaScript.
• Better solution for Web application user interfaces
10. WebGL
• WebGL is a cross-platform web standard
• Low-level 3D graphics API based on OpenGL
ES 2.0 (Shaders/GLSL)
• Exposed through the HTML5 Canvas element
as Document Object Model interfaces.
• canvas context mode :
CanvasRenderingContext2D
WebGLRenderingContext
13. Libraries
• PaperJS – Hard to Debug – PaperScript
• Easel.js/Kinetic.js/Fabric.js
• ProcessingJS – Own language - .pde files
• RaphaelJS – SVG in every browser
• ThreeJS - http://threejs.org/ - 3D JS – WebGL
• SeriouslyJS – Interesting WebGL library
(Your shortcut to useful shaders – Great for
video and image manipulation)
